Try using different compress formats overriding the default (xv) with the "-c" parameter:
optirun -c jpeg glxgears althoug some compression formats are not fluent and take a high load on the main processor. -- Joaquín Ignacio Aramendía <[email protected]> El mié, 01-06-2011 a las 18:13 +0800, Wei-Ning Huang escribió: > Hi list, > > > I can confirm bumblebee working on Acer 4750G(NV GT540M).
